Dr. Roger K. Mahr, past AVMA President and iconic One Health leader, was awarded the coveted and prestigious AVOHS “K.F. Meyer-James H. Steele Gold Headed Caneat the 2026 American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A) – Annual Convention in Anaheim, California.

A prominent American veterinarian who served as the 2006–2007 president of the American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A) and is widely recognized as a visionary pioneer of the global "One Health" movement. During his AVMA presidency, he championed the "One World, One Health, One Medicine" concept, advocating for an interdisciplinary approach to link human, animal, and environmental health. His leadership directly led to the formation of the One Health Initiative Task Force and the subsequent establishment of the One Health Commission in 2009, where he served as its first Chief Executive Officer (CEO).

  • Dr. Mahr received a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) degree from Iowa State University College of Veterinary Medicine in 1971.  A small animal practitioner for over 35 years, in 1974 he founded and operated the Meadow View Veterinary Clinic in Geneva, Illinois.
  • Served as president of the Chicago Veterinary Medical Association and the Illinois State Veterinary Medical Association (ISVMA).
  • Honored with the prestigious AVMA Award in 2019 for outstanding contributions to the advancement of veterinary medicine and organizational leadership.
  • Philanthropy includes having endowed the Dr. Roger and Marilyn Mahr Professorship in One Health at Iowa State University.  This provides continued training for future generations in multi-disciplinary health collaborations.
